About Saint Peter’s University

Saint Peter’s is one of 27 Jesuit colleges and universities in the United States. Established in 1872, the University blends a unique learning experience shaped by rigorous academics, internships that provide real-world experience, community service, and a genuine, caring community that supports alumni long after graduation. Saint Peter’s offers more than 50 undergraduate majors as well as master’s level and doctorate program.

Job Summary:

The History Department at Saint Peter’s University invites applications for an adjunct faculty position to teach undergraduate courses in either premodern history or modern world history.

Duties & Responsibilities:

  • Teach one or more sections of premodern history (e.g., ancient, medieval, or early modern) or modern world history courses per term

  • Develop syllabi, deliver lectures/discussions, and assess student learning in accordance with departmental standards

  • Be available to support student learning through virtual meetings or office hours

  • Maintain accurate records of attendance and grades
